Zlín Weather in July
During July, Zlín experiences high daytime temperatures of 26°C (79°F) and cooler nights around 14°C (57°F). As the wettest month of the year, and part of the summer season, expect frequent rainfall.
Rainfall in Zlín in July
During the wettest month of the year, an umbrella can be your best friend to stay dry. Expect around 14 days of rain based on historical data, with 103 mm (4.1 in) average. Rainfall intensity is on the higher side this month. Expect more substantial showers rather than light, passing rain.
Temperature in Zlín in July
Temperatures in Zlín in July top out at 26°C (79°F) and drop to 14°C (57°F) overnight. Experience the summer season in July. Conditions stay fairly consistent through the month, making it easier to plan what to wear. Nights cool down to 14°C (57°F), so a light jacket or extra layer is useful once the sun goes down. On the plus side, the cooler nights make for comfortable sleeping conditions.
Sunshine in Zlín in July
The month enjoys around 245 hours of sunshine, creating mostly sunny days with good weather conditions.If your ideal day consists of dry skies and pleasant temperatures, May, June, August and September typically offer the best circumstances for Zlín.

Zlín historical weather extremes in July
The extremes listed below come from historical weather data collected in Zlín from 1976 through 2025.
- The warmest day in July was on July 20, 2007, with a maximum of 36°C (97°F).
- The lowest daytime temperature in July was 12°C (54°F), recorded on July 16, 2000.
- Zlín registered its coldest July night on July 2, 2018, with temperatures dropping to 5°C (41°F).
- The wettest day in July Zlín was on July 1, 2024 with 61 mm (2.4 in) of precipitation.

What to Wear in Zlín in July
Warm temperatures in July make for comfortable sightseeing weather. Pack breathable fabrics like cotton shirts, knee-length shorts or skirts, and comfortable walking shoes. A thin long sleeve for indoor spaces is handy. Prepare for significant rainfall with proper waterproof clothing and shoes. Don't forget sun protection, sunglasses, sunscreen, and a hat.
